How To Fix UKM_EM010 - Activity &1 event &2 triggered


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: UKM_EM - SAP Credit Management: Event Manager Messages

  • Message number: 010

  • Message text: Activity &1 event &2 triggered

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message UKM_EM010 - Activity &1 event &2 triggered ?

    The SAP error message UKM_EM010, which states "Activity &1 event &2 triggered," is related to the SAP Credit Management module, specifically within the context of the SAP Risk Management component. This message typically indicates that a specific activity or event has been triggered in the system, which may require further investigation or action.

    Cause:

    The error message UKM_EM010 can be triggered by various factors, including:

    1. Credit Limit Exceeded: The customer may have exceeded their credit limit, which triggers an event in the credit management process.
    2. Risk Assessment: A risk assessment may have been triggered due to changes in customer data or transaction patterns.
    3. Manual Intervention: A user may have manually triggered an event related to credit management activities.
    4. Configuration Issues: There may be issues with the configuration of the credit management settings in the system.

    Solution:

    To resolve the UKM_EM010 error, consider the following steps:

    1. Review Customer Credit Data: Check the credit limit and current credit exposure for the customer involved. Ensure that the credit limit is set appropriately and that the customer is within their limit.

    2. Analyze the Triggered Event: Identify what specific activity (Activity &1) and event (Event &2) have been triggered. This information can help you understand the context of the error.

    3. Check Configuration Settings: Review the configuration settings for credit management in the SAP system. Ensure that all necessary parameters are set correctly.

    4. Consult Logs and Documentation: Look at the application logs (transaction SLG1) for more detailed information about the error. This can provide insights into what caused the event to trigger.

    5. User Training: If the event was triggered by manual intervention, ensure that users are trained on the correct procedures for handling credit management activities.

    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ot determine the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
